Dane County Farmers' Market runs 6:15 a.m. to 1:45 p.m. Facebook WebMay 5, 2024 · The Dane County Farmers’ Market on the Square is a Wednesday and Saturday tradition in Madison, Wisconsin. There are approximately 275 vendors at the market, selling seasonal vegetables, flowers, meats, cheeses, and specialty products. All of the items for sale are grown, raised, and produced in Wisconsin.

Web1 hour ago · Dane County Farmers’ Market: The largest producer-only market in the United States is back on Capitol Square, running from 6:15 a.m. to 1:45 p.m. each Saturday through Nov. 11, rain or shine. Founded in September 1972 with five farmers, it has grown to some 130 vendors each week around the Capitol. Free admission. dcfm.org
